What is the Prime Factorization of 760000?
or
Explanation of number 760000 Prime Factorization
Prime Factorization of 760000 it is expressing 760000 as the product of prime factors. In other words it is finding which prime numbers should be multiplied together to make 760000.
Since number 760000 is a Composite number (not Prime) we can do its Prime Factorization.
To get a list of all Prime Factors of 760000, we have to iteratively divide 760000 by the smallest prime number possible until the result equals 1.
Here is the complete solution of finding Prime Factors of 760000:
The smallest Prime Number which can divide 760000 without a remainder is 2. So the first calculation step would look like:
760000 ÷ 2 = 380000
Now we repeat this action until the result equals 1:
380000 ÷ 2 = 190000
190000 ÷ 2 = 95000
95000 ÷ 2 = 47500
47500 ÷ 2 = 23750
23750 ÷ 2 = 11875
11875 ÷ 5 = 2375
2375 ÷ 5 = 475
475 ÷ 5 = 95
95 ÷ 5 = 19
19 ÷ 19 = 1
Now we have all the Prime Factors for number 760000. It is: 2, 2, 2, 2, 2, 2, 5, 5, 5, 5, 19
Or you may also write it in exponential form: 26 × 54 × 19
